What's so hard to understand???

A calorie IS a calorie if you are looking to simply lose weight.  In other words, if you want to lose 30 pounds in 2-3 months, make sure to only eat 1000 calories or less per day, regardless of what you eat.  Doing this, you will lose a lot of weight, but your body composition will look shitty.

A calorie IS not a calorie if you want to actually look slim and muscular.  If you consume a decent amount of protein, fats & carbs, all the while maintaining a caloric deficit under 1000 calories, you will also lose a lot of weight, but your end result will be slightly better by way of retaining more muscle mass.

The major difference between the first scenario and the second is that during the first scenario, you don't have to worry about doing any form of exercise.  In the second scenario, exercise will make a huge difference.
